内容説明
This is a graduate level text and reference on the design of relational databases. It applies the entity- relationship model to the conceptual level of database design, and combines this application with rigorous treatment of the design of relational schemas. The book presents practical design theory and methods in a unified way. Features * Introduces unique material on: two level database design between the entity-relationship model and the relationship model, iterative database design, simple and intuitive integrity constraints, new algorithms and Design-By-Example (DBE) , a tool currently under development in Finland. * Includes coverage of the physical design of database and object-oriented databases. * Excellent use of examples.
